Fully tunable filter‐antenna with microstrip and quarter‐mode substrate‐integrated waveguide hybrid structure

This letter proposed a filter‐antenna with continuously adjustable center frequency and bandwidth. The proposed filter‐antenna employs a hybrid structure of a microstrip and quarter‐mode substrate‐integrated waveguide (QSIW). The simulation and test results show that the CF of the filter‐antenna can be continuously tuned between 1.35GHz and 1.472GHz, and the 10‐dB BW is continuously tuned between 30 MHz‐104 MHz. The simulated antenna radiation pattern can maintain good stability in the adjustable range.
